Things to Know about Traveling to South Khorasan, Iran in Winter
Languages: Persian (Farsi) is primarily spoken.
Currency: Iranian Rial (IRR) is the currency.
Timezone: Iran Standard Time (IRST).
Internet: Public internet is available, but access may be limited due to infrastructure and regulations.
Weather in South Khorasan, Iran
Winter: Cold and dry, with temperatures often dropping below freezing.
Spring: Mild temperatures with occasional rain.
Summer: Hot and dry, with temperatures often exceeding 35°C (95°F).
Fall: Cooler temperatures and dry conditions.
South Khorasan, a gem in Iran's east, offers a unique blend of cultural heritage and natural beauty, making it a fascinating place to explore during wintertime. The region experiences cold desert climate conditions, so while temperatures can drop significantly, the days are often sunny and clear. This weather provides a perfect opportunity to enjoy the sun-drenched landscapes that stretch across the horizon, blanketed in a serene winter chill.
For the culturally curious traveler, South Khorasan is a treasure trove. Birjand, the capital, is renowned for its Qanat water systems, an ingenious ancient method of irrigation still in use today and recognized as a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Moreover, South Khorasan is home to the stunning Kakhk Citadel and the Arg-e Kharanagh, whose historical charms attract history buffs from around the globe.
Travelers should also savor the local flavors, with warm and aromatic Persian dishes offering comfort against the cold. From saffron-infused dishes to the regional specialty jujube, South Khorasan offers a culinary adventure to warm the soul. Packing Checklist for a Trip to South Khorasan, Iran in Winter
Clothing
Heavy winter coat
Thermal underwear
Sweaters
Wool socks
Warm hat
Gloves
Scarf
Winter boots
Toiletries
Toothbrush and toothpaste
Deodorant
Moisturizer
Lip balm
Shampoo and conditioner
Soap or body wash
Electronics
Smartphone and charger
Camera with extra batteries
Power bank
Universal travel adapter
Documents
Passport
Visa (if required)
Travel insurance documents
Flight tickets
Hotel reservation confirmations
Local maps and guidebooks
Health And Safety
First aid kit
Prescription medications
Hand sanitizer
Face masks
Sunscreen (for high altitude protection)
Miscellaneous
Snacks and water bottle
Sunglasses
Notebook and pen
Travel Accessories
Suitcase with wheels
Daypack or backpack
Money belt or hidden pouch
Outdoor Gear
Warm hiking pants
Insulated jacket
Headlamp or flashlight
Entertainment
Books or e-reader
Travel journal
Podcast or music playlists
